This is the type of rumor that checks all the boxes notable name that even marginal hockey fans know, player on the outs, certain hall-of-famer going to a team with a supposed need at his position. So why does it have next to no chance to happening? Because of a tiny but significant problem: Brodeur isnt a good goalie anymore. A quick search on . Currently Brodeur owns an even-strength save percentage of .901 in 29 games. There are two goalies in the league who have played 20 games with a worse save percentage. One is the Islanders Kevin Poulin at .900 and the other is Devan Dubnyk, who already has been traded once, at .898. Poulin is in the minors now and Dubnyk was waived yesterday. As you can see, if Brodeur hasnt been the worst Juventus Jersey goalie in the league this year, hes been close. But he certainly the worst value in the league. Brodeurs cap hit this year is $4.5 million. Dubnyks is $1.75 million. Poulin is $577,500. Martin Brodeur may not be good enough to be an NHL backup, at this point. Hes certainly not worth what hes being paid. The idea that anyone would give up something of value to a player who, thanks to his contract, is a net negative, seems unlikely. If you had to give up something of value, Jaroslav Halak, who makes le s money, is a better deal. If you dont want to give up something of value pretty much any other backup in the league is a better option to try to catch lightning in a bottle. That includes the current starter in Minnesota. Darcy Kuemper, the guy Brodeur would be replacing at the moment, has a .938 even strength save percentage in 18 games this year. And his cap hit is $776,667. Sure, anything is po sible. Maybe some GM will be enamored by the name and the resume, even if its no longer up to date. That GM would need to have their head examined, but until a trade actually goes down, it seems highly unlikely. But with the NHL trade deadline fast approaching, so expect plenty more unlikely scenarios in the next 24 hours. Get your shovel ready.
